Why in the News? On June 26, 2025, multiple districts in Himachal Pradesh were battered by cloudbursts, triggering devastating flash floods. As per official reports, three bodies were recovered in Kangra, taking the death toll to five. The Kullu district was particularly affected, with cloudburst incidents recorded in Banjar, Gadsa, Manikaran, and Sainj.
